Making expanded clay concrete blocks with your own hands

With a few simple tools and materials, you can create your own expanded clay concrete blocks at home, which are a versatile and environmentally friendly building material. These blocks are perfect for a variety of construction projects because they combine the durability and strength of concrete with the light weight of expanded clay. Expanded clay concrete blocks can be an affordable and environmentally friendly option for building a shed, garden wall, or even a small house.

To make these blocks at home, you need to combine cement, water, and expanded clay aggregate into a workable concrete mixture. Once the mixture reaches the proper consistency, you can shape your blocks by pouring it into molds. You’ll have strong, lightweight blocks that are prepared for use in your projects after letting them cure.

Step Description
1. Gather materials Collect cement, expanded clay, sand, and water.
2. Mix ingredients Combine cement, sand, and water to make a basic concrete mix. Then add expanded clay.
3. Prepare molds Oil the molds to ensure the blocks don"t stick.
4. Pour mix into molds Fill the molds with the concrete mixture evenly.
5. Remove air bubbles Tap the molds to release any trapped air.
6. Let it set Allow the blocks to set for 24 hours.
7. Cure the blocks Keep the blocks moist and let them cure for at least a week.
8. Remove from molds Carefully take the blocks out of the molds.
9. Finish curing Continue to cure the blocks for another week to reach full strength.

Required materials and tools

You will need to gather specialized tools when constructing a structure using a lot of expanded clay concrete blocks, like if you decided to build your own house:

  • a concrete mixer (it is better to take a container of at least 130 liters), depending on the company, its cost can be 9.5-12 thousand. rub.;
  • manual machine for vibration pressing: it can be purchased at a hardware store for 7.5-10 thousand. rub. or order directly from the manufacturer; molds for pouring in such designs are already provided, so there is no need to buy or make them separately; if desired, it can be made by yourself from a metal tabletop and an old working engine.

Experience has shown that it is feasible to produce roughly 160 blocks in a full working day when team members are working together, provided they have the right tools and a sufficient number of molds. A manufacturing machine that is mechanical can produce one to four blocks in a cycle (one to two minutes). The number of finished products will increase by two times if you hire a few more helpers to help bring, fill in raw materials, and drag the finished products.

One can create a limited quantity of blocks without specialized tools. In this instance, all that’s required is choosing a container of the right size to mix the solution in and creating pouring molds.

Making molds

You can use multiple separate forms as well as general formwork to make the blocks yourself. The product tray (bottom) and two letter "L"-shaped side pieces are assembled to form the matrices. Plastic, metal, or a standard 20 mm board can be used to make them. The dimensions of a standard block are 39x19x19.

It is preferable to use metal corners to secure wooden forms and thin-walled metal to cover the interior. If not, they will take up moisture from the mixture, which could weaken subsequent goods. If you don’t have any metal, you can use machine oil to coat the container’s bottom and side walls. Additionally, it will shield the matrix from moisture.

In addition to saving mortar, the blocks’ voids provide air spaces for the walls to improve thermal conductivity. Three round or rectangular cylinders need to be inserted inside the molds in order to produce hollow products. They are attached to one another and then fastened with screws to the mold’s side sections to keep them from moving.

You can even use regular plastic bottles to make voids when making fewer blocks. It is preferable to fill them with water to make them heavier in these situations. Once the mold is two thirds full of solution, they must be put into it.

Preparing the solution

Mixing expanded clay concrete by hand is simple. A 1:3:8 mixture of cement, sand, and expanded clay is used to create a high-quality solution. Although the amount of water added also depends on the dry mixture’s initial moisture content, it is added at a rate of 200 liters per 1 m3. What we’ll need to make expanded clay concrete blocks is:

  • expanded clay with a strength of P150-200: it is better not to use fractions larger than 5-10 mm, since the blocks will be shapeless, and their strength will be significantly lower;
  • sand: to obtain high-quality products, use sand enriched with gravel, it is not recommended to use ordinary river sand;
  • cement M400-500;
  • water;
  • plasticizers: ordinary liquid soap, washing powder or dishwashing detergent are often used as plasticizers, you will need 1% of the total amount of cement; for a 130 l concrete mixer, you can take about 70 g of soap; you can increase the plasticity of the solution not only with soap, but also by adding clay, lime or wood ash to it.

A high-quality homogeneous solution requires that the components be added to the mixture in a specific order in addition to paying attention to the proportions. The precise volume of water is measured first. Only after thoroughly combining expanded clay, sand, and cement is the resulting dry mixture added to the liquid. The prepared solution should have a consistency similar to that of softened plasticine.

Without a concrete mixer, how can expanded clay concrete be made? In this instance, you will need to put in a lot of effort and use a shovel to thoroughly mix the solution. You will need to dilute the solution in small amounts in this situation because lumps that aren’t mixed in can lower the quality of the finished goods. The answer is prepared. Manufacturing blocks

The presence of a vibrating machine is necessary for the production of large quantities of expanded clay because the material is light and will always float in the solution. If it isn’t present, each form needs to be pressed down until "cement milk" shows up using a thin wooden block. A hand rammer can be used to press solid products.

Utilizing a vibrating device makes the task much easier. The excess solution is removed after it has been poured into steel forms. After a few seconds, the engine is started to allow the solution to somewhat settle. After leveling the mixture and removing any excess, restart the vibrator for five to seven seconds. Switch off the device. You must turn the machine’s handle until it stops in order to remove the molds.

Drying

The blocks will take roughly two days to dry in the mold. This time may extend during periods of rain and moisture. It is preferable to stack three to four completed expanded clay concrete blocks in a row on pallets for storage. Even drying of the final products will be facilitated by the air space between the pallets.

After the blocks have been removed from the mold, place them under a canopy to allow them to dry out and avoid exposure to sunlight and precipitation. They are wrapped in cellophane film and moistened with water during the summer. After one to one and a half weeks, you can begin working with them. But the best course of action would be to let them dry for a month, as only then will the cement fully develop its brand strength. The blocks need to be cleared of any irregularities before work can begin. Dried mortar drips can be removed using an ordinary knife.
